Sample rhythm
Sunrise boat trip past African fish eagles calling from the acacias, jacanas walking on lily pads, and hippo pods stirring at dawn.
Kenya's last rainforest fragment. Guided pre-dawn walks for the great blue turaco, Ross's turaco and a chorus of hornbills overhead.
Cliff-nesting raptors at Bogoria's escarpment and pelagic birding by boat on Baringo — over 470 species recorded between the two lakes.
Open-country species — secretary birds, ostrich, bustards — spotted between sightings of the Mara's resident big cats.
